Installation Technician - PorchLight Services
Sioux Falls, SD 57108
About the Job
We are looking to grow our low-voltage field team. Be a part of a team that installs audio and video products in settings that range from smart homes, event halls, exterior sound and camera systems, and much more. If you like variety in your work and want to be a part of a growing company, apply!
Pay expectation: $18-$30/ hour depending on experience
Overtime eligible
Requirements
Job Requirements:
· Cable runs and equipment installation for low voltage systems in commercial and residential settings.
· Use of manual & electric hand tools, working with ladders & lifts, and the ability to properly lift (75) pounds unassisted necessary along with managing time well.
· Ability to work from up to 24' extension ladder and scissor lifts.
· Able to travel out of town some days with some overnights (approx. 10 to 20 nights a year). No weekends.
· Any experience with installation of cabling, cameras, and alarm fixtures is a plus, but we will train with the right candidate.
· Knowledge of general building construction, reading blueprints & working with Windows-based software helpful.
· A clear & clean criminal background check, satisfactory driving record with no DUI history, and passing pre-employment and random drug testing.
· Ability to perform work according to directives, possess a positive “can-do” attitude and be a team contributor.
Must have a valid drivers License
